Position Summary and Responsibilities
The Administrative Assistant provides administrative and operational support to the Department of Art. The Administrative Assistant assists the department chair, faculty, staff, students, and visitors with administrative functions.
Responsibilities:
- Report to and work closely with the department chair on all
subjects including annual reports, staffing plans, course masters,
and professional correspondence.
- Serve as a primary contact for students and visitors, answer
the department phone, respond to email queries, meet the needs of
students and visitors as they come into the office. etc.
- Assist faculty with preparation of course and professional
materials, reimbursements.
- Maintain the shared department calendar for semester deadlines,
meetings, events. This includes room reservations.
- Supervise the student office intern and placement of student
employees.
- Coordinate with the Registrar office regarding class schedules,
enrollments, student records, curricular changes, etc.
- Maintain and reconcile department budgets, endowment funds.
Assist with annual allocations requests.
- Organize paperwork for faculty & staff
reimbursements.
- Place and track orders as requested by faculty and staff.
Maintain inventory for office and other department
supplies.
- Assist in the purchase and renewal of annual service contracts
for equipment.
- Distribute department mail to faculty and staff
mailboxes.
- Report building problems to Facilities Operations, and maintain
log of ongoing and completed building repairs.
- Organize and maintain all department records. This includes
confidential personnel files and letters, and faculty assessment
materials.
- Provide travel arrangements, accommodations, interview and meal
schedules for department job candidates. This includes assisting
faculty with professional travel arrangements and guest speaker
arrangement.
- Update department website as needed.
- Participate actively in departmental special events, which
includes organizing events, catering, student orientation
etc.
- Perform other duties as assigned.
Qualifications
- A minimum of two to four years administrative support
experience and/or training.
- Ability to interact effectively with a diverse community of
students, faculty, staff and visitors.
- Ability to effectively manage deadlines and multiple competing
priorities while maintaining attention to detail and exercising
good judgment.
- Strong organizational and time management skills are
required.
- Must exercise discretion and maintain
confidentiality.
- Maintain a professional problem-solving demeanor during
sometimes stressful situations.
- Ability to work independently and with other departments on
campus including Accounts Payable, Registrar, Purchasing, Student
Employment, Human Resources, Building & Grounds and Campus
Activities.
- Strong computer skills are required including proficiency with
both Mac and PC platform environments, Microsoft Word, Microsoft
Excel, Google’s suite of tools (gmail, calendar, drive, docs,
etc.), Workday (or comparable database systems), and a variety of
email and internet browsers. Must be open to learning new software
as needed.
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ills and telephone manner are essential.
